Report for 2014 Feb
                   Monthly Climatological Summary for Feb 2014

Name: City Centre   City: Palmerston North   State: Manawatu
Elevation: 23 m  Lat: S 40° 21' 15"   Lon: E 175° 37' 34"

                  Temperature (°C), Rain (mm), Wind Speed (km/h)

                                      Heat  Cool        Avg
    Mean                              Deg   Deg         Wind                 Dom
Day Temp  High   Time   Low    Time   Days  Days  Rain  Speed High   Time    Dir
----------------------------------------------------------------------------------
 1  18.1  24.5   14:56  13.7   23:58   1.6   1.4   0.0   8.1  34.2   12:19   ESE
 2  17.3  23.0   16:04  12.4   03:24   2.1   1.1   0.0   9.7  33.1   16:50     E
 3  19.6  28.7   15:53  12.0   06:57   1.9   3.1   0.0   8.5  22.0   02:03     E
 4  18.3  24.8   14:14  11.6   06:42   2.0   1.9   0.0  10.5  33.1   17:03     W
 5  19.8  25.0   18:22  16.0   07:14   0.7   2.2   0.0  15.9  41.8   10:14     W
 6  17.2  22.4   14:05  13.7   06:07   1.8   0.8   0.0  17.6  47.9   16:09     E
 7  18.3  23.6   13:21  14.4   05:53   1.3   1.2   0.0  21.3  40.3   13:04     E
 8  20.0  24.7   14:30  17.2   07:39   0.1   1.8  20.7   8.8  29.5   20:58   ESE
 9  19.8  23.9   12:56  17.4   23:29   0.1   1.7   0.0   7.3  25.6   13:21   SSE
10  17.6  20.2   13:37  16.0   23:28   0.9   0.3   0.3   5.7  27.0   12:27   SSE
11  17.6  20.3   11:11  15.0   06:59   1.3   0.5   0.0   7.7  22.0   14:47     W
12  17.9  23.1   13:40  14.6   06:23   1.3   0.9   0.0  14.0  40.3   15:11   WNW
13  17.5  21.6   13:52  14.4   05:23   1.6   0.7   0.3  22.9  54.0   12:22   WNW
14  17.2  21.6   15:40  14.7   05:19   1.6   0.5   1.2  19.5  41.8   16:10   WNW
15  18.8  24.5   14:42  14.8   23:58   1.2   1.7   0.0   9.9  29.5   16:07   WNW
16  20.0  29.1   13:58  11.2   07:01   2.1   3.8   0.0   8.5  34.2   16:10   ENE
17  21.5  30.8   14:17  14.7   06:13   0.9   4.1   0.0   6.4  24.5   15:12   SSW
18  20.7  28.7   14:31  13.9   06:55   1.1   3.6   0.0   8.6  31.7   14:04     W
19  23.7  33.6   15:07  16.1   06:20   0.4   5.8   0.0   6.1  29.5   13:35     E
20  22.8  30.8   14:59  16.4   06:47   0.2   4.8   0.0   8.9  35.6   16:51     E
21  22.0  28.6   15:04  17.2   06:52   0.1   3.8   0.0   8.5  27.0   16:36     W
22  21.4  27.9   13:15  18.0   19:46   0.0   3.1   0.0  15.9  40.3   12:46     W
23  18.2  22.4   13:16  12.7   23:54   1.0   0.9   0.0  22.6  54.0   12:25   WNW
24  16.7  26.2   13:34  10.7   06:47   3.1   1.5   0.0  10.0  31.7   19:12   WNW
25  18.5  25.6   14:44  14.1   04:16   1.8   2.0   0.0  10.4  37.8   18:15   ENE
26  18.5  23.5   14:29  15.0   03:05   1.2   1.4   0.0  17.6  35.6   15:08     E
27  19.3  28.7   13:26  12.6   07:09   1.7   2.7   0.0   9.1  25.6   17:06     W
28  17.9  23.8   14:27  14.2   23:58   1.3   0.9   0.0  18.4  51.5   17:06   WNW
----------------------------------------------------------------------------------
    19.2  33.6    19    10.7    24    34.4  58.2  22.5  12.1  54.0    13     WNW

Max >=  27.0:  9
Max <=   0.0:  0
Min <=   0.0:  0
Min <= -18.0:  0
Max Rain: 20.7 on day 8
Days of Rain: 4 (>= 0.2 mm)  1 (>= 2.0 mm)  1 (>= 20.0 mm)
Heat Base: 18.3  Cool Base: 18.3  Method: Integration
